Nottingham Forest vs Sheffield United: Both to Score? NO

Gameweek two gets underway at the City Ground on Friday night, as both of these sides look for their first points of the Premier League season.

Nottingham Forest will take comfort in their spirited comeback against Arsenal, which very nearly saw them claw back the unlikeliest of draws.

Considering eight of their nine wins came on home soil last season, the Forest faithful will be pleased to see their side back in the Midlands. They will not want to rely too heavily on their home form to keep them afloat after relegation edged a little too close for comfort, but Sheffield United face a tall order if they are to get a result here.

The Blades’ 1-0 defeat in their return to the top-flight doesn’t wholly paint the picture of what transpired last weekend, where Crystal Palace utterly dominated in every department.

Sheffield registered the second-lowest xG of the weekend and had just 32% possession on their home turf. With Forests’ strong home record at the forefront of our thinking, we can see the hosts keeping a clean sheet here.

Nottingham Forest vs Sheffield United: Forest to Win 

If it hadn’t been for their 30 points at the City Ground, Forest would have almost certainly been condemned to relegation last season.

Managing to avoid defeat in 14 out of a possible 19 is a more than commendable record, placing them in the top half when isolating home form.

This is a bad omen for Sheffield United, who struggled to impose themselves against Palace even in front of their home fans.

It is hard to see anything other than a Nottingham Forest win here to get their season up and running.
